Hi, You can not set cluster position directly it is generated like UUID.
On Wed, Apr 2, 2014 at 4:46 PM, Nhat Nguyen <[email protected]>wrote: > Hi, > > i tried saving document to a specific ClusterPosition in a specific > Cluster. After some attempts the database won´t do this. > > Here is an example: > > ODatabaseDocumentTx db = ODatabaseDocumentPool.global().acquire( > "local:.....", "admin", "admin" ); > Person p = new Person(); > p.setName( "Herbert" ); > p.setAge( 22 ); > > try > { > db.begin( TXTYPE.OPTIMISTIC ); > ODocument document = db.newInstance( "Person" ); > > //setting the place where this document will be stored > //sad part ist that orientdb immediatly thinks that this action is an > update (cause of the given position) not an insert. > document.setIdentity(9, new OClusterPositionLong(255)); > > //insert the data into the document > document.field("Name", p.getName()); > document.field("Age", p.getAge()); > > document.save(); > //document.save(true); > //db.save(document); > db.commit(); > } > catch(Exception e){ > db.rollback(); > e.printStackTrace(); > } > finally > { > db.close(); > } > > > does anyone has an idea?
